Washburn took down Gatlinburg-Pittman on Monday, a win that might not have happened without Bryson Clay's effort. Clay produced his best game of the campaign: he went 1-for-2 with one triple, one run, and one RBI. That triple was his first of the season.
Looking ahead, Clay and Washburn will host West Greene at 5:00 p.m. on Thursday. Clay had to take a loss the last time the two teams duked it out, losing their matchup last Friday 4-3.
